commit 90d407e2bf9dbd0ab624e8d66b0f65b1faec2443
parent c3afec4d2182577d53dd9ca9ae95cdaa50951f05
Author: Amin Mesbah <mesbahamin@gmail.com>
Date: Sat, 11 Nov 2017 17:01:03 -0800
Add warning flags to GCC
- `-Wfloat-equal`: warn about float equality comparisons
- `-Wswitch-enum`: make sure switch statements on enums include a case
for every enum code.
Diffstat:
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/Makefile b/Makefile
@@ -1,5 +1,5 @@
CC = gcc
-CFLAGS = -std=c99 -Wall -Wextra -Wpedantic -Wshadow -Wno-unused-parameter
+CFLAGS = -std=c99 -Wall -Wextra -Wfloat-equal -Wpedantic -Wshadow -Wswitch-enum -Wno-unused-parameter
LDFLAGS = $(SDL_LDFLAGS) -lm
SDL_CFLAGS := $(shell sdl2-config --cflags)